Dive into the sophisticated world of jazz with George Shearing's "Continental Experience," a captivating collection of cool jazz and vocal jazz gems released on September 5, 2014, under the esteemed MPS label. Spanning a concise yet engaging 38 minutes, this album is a testament to Shearing's mastery and his ability to blend timeless classics with his unique musical perspective.
The tracklist is a journey through beloved standards and lesser-known treasures, each song showcasing Shearing's signature style and virtuosity. From the dreamy allure of "Lullaby of Birdland" to the tender romance of "The Nearness of You," and the playful charm of "The Continental," the album offers a diverse and enriching listening experience. Shearing's interpretations of "To a Wild Rose" and "Roses of Picardy" bring a fresh, jazzy twist to these classic pieces, while his rendition of "East of the Sun" is a standout, highlighting his exceptional skill and artistry.
